Subject: DR drill — Ashgrove donation-receipt mailer

Hi,

As part of Thursday's disaster-recovery drill, you'll restore the Ashgrove receipt mailer in the standby region. Templates and the send queue are in the sealed backup vault; restore those first, then verify a test receipt renders. To unseal the backup vault during the drill, use the recovery passphrase provided below.

recovery phrase for fawif-tajeg: norael-aldmir-casir-brivan-ulaion

## Ticket: Telemetry compression config drift

For the weekly sync: Pulsegate nodes are compressing telemetry payloads inconsistently. Three regions run zstd at level 6, two still run gzip, and one has compression disabled entirely, inflating egress costs on the Averdale link. Root cause looks like a partial rollout in March that never finished. Proposal: enforce the canonical settings via the config controller and alert on divergence. The values every node should converge to are listed below.

service settings:
[ulair]
team = praath
access_code = ac_06d704
owner = wenix.ulair
host = ulair.qirvancorp.corp
port = 9200
peer = sorys.nelvronet.internal
salt = 2668132c
pin = 9140

## Formula sandbox tuning

User-supplied formulas in Gridmoor execute inside a restricted interpreter with hard ceilings on time, memory, and call depth. Reviewers should confirm any change to these ceilings is justified in the PR description, since raising them widens the abuse surface. Defaults were chosen from production traces. The current limits are as follows.

limits module of tafog-fawip:
WEIGHTS = {
    "julix": 57,
    "lamys": 992,
    "kasvan": 209,
    "quenok": 750,
    "alddor": 259,
    "oliath": 1009,
    "wenix": 815,
}